About this work area About this work area As People Planning Manager your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:
Implementing all people planning strategies in accordance with the unit’s priorities, ensuring the People Planning promise, principles, and processes are adhered to as localised by Country P&C.
Securing and monitoring adherence to IKEA's employment standards for working and scheduling, local labour law legislations, and union requirements related to People Planning.
Acting as a business partner to all department managers on people planning topics, develop and monitor schedules, and secure time registration processes to align with the unit’s hours forecast and business priorities, while promoting co-worker empowerment.
Proposing solutions to address planning gaps within agreed financial frames and growth potential, based on thorough analyses of scheduled and actual hours. Collaborate with unit P&C Manager and Business Navigation on business forecasts and suggested areas of opportunity.
Implementing and optimising the use of all people planning digital systems and tools and analyse relevant people planning data and KPIs to improve efficiency.
Consolidating budget hours, tasks catalogue, and workload drivers into workload requirements and distribute hours over time accordingly.
Designing an optimal contract level and mix, and a People Capacity plan by analysing the current staffing structure, availability requirements, and qualification needs against future business needs.
Identifying future people capacity gaps and initiate schedule optimisation processes.
Reviewing all new recruitments against defined headcount, contract level, contract type, and capacity requirements to ensure co-workers create a great customer experience.
Developing and leading education, training, and support in all people planning and timekeeping processes at the unit, continuously raising awareness and knowledge of these processes.
Identifying and develop talent to ensure competence development and succession planning for people planning specialists by providing knowledge transfer, expertise, and training in all aspects of the people planning process.
Reviewing the timekeeping process in the unit, follow up on timely execution and process knowledge, and ensure necessary improvements.
As People Planning Manager you have:
A strong background in people planning, with a deep understanding of employment standards, local labour laws, and union requirements.
An analytical mindset with the ability to interpret complex data and propose effective solutions.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, capable of acting as a business partner to department managers.
Proficiency in using digital systems and tools for people planning and have experience analysing relevant data and KPIs.
You are proactive in identifying capacity gaps and initiating optimisation processes, with a focus on re-skilling and recruitment.
You are committed to developing and leading education and training initiatives to enhance people planning processes.
You have a talent for identifying and developing future leaders, ensuring competence development and succession planning.
